ENDS OF THE EARTH
Faelwen has spent her life walking roads most people never know need guarding.
Raised between two inheritances-Dúnedain blood and the fading grace of the Elves-she followed in her late father's footsteps and became a Ranger of the North. With sharpened senses, an Elven-forged polearm at her back, and far too much sarcasm for her own good, Faelwen has learned how to track monsters, survive the wild, and hide every wound that cannot be stitched.
Then the Orcs begin moving strangely.
Following their trail farther east than duty usually carries her, Faelwen enters the shadowed reaches of Mirkwood expecting answers.
Instead, an arrow kills the Orc she needed alive.
And the irritating Elf responsible happens to be Legolas, son of Thranduil.
Legolas has known the Woodland Realm for longer than Faelwen can comprehend, yet the mortal Ranger who walks through his forest with Elven grace and absolutely no respect for his title proves far more difficult to understand. What begins as suspicion becomes reluctant cooperation, then friendship-and, slowly, something neither of them is prepared to name.
But darkness is spreading through Middle-earth.
A company of Dwarves is approaching the Lonely Mountain. An ancient enemy is stirring in the south of Mirkwood. Kingdoms will fall, dragons will wake, and the years ahead will carry Faelwen and Legolas to opposite ends of the earth and back again.
For Faelwen, time has always been precious because she knows it will run out.
For Legolas, time has never needed to matter.
Until her.
Because loving a mortal means accepting the ending before the story has truly begun.
And sometimes, the things destined to end are still worth choosing.
A Legolas x OC slow-burn romance spanning The Hobbit and The Lord of the Rings, following canon from the spaces between the pages.
